Pennsylvania- based Commerce Bank/Harrisburg (CBH) has announced that it will officially operate under its new brand name, Metro Bank, from June 13, 2009. The bank’s parent company, Pennsylvania Commerce Bancorp will begin operating as Metro Bancorp from June 15, 2009 and Metro Bancorp will trade on the under the stock ticker symbol METR.

Additionally, the bank has extended its store hours and introduced a new model of its free coin-counting machine. The new Metro Bank will also offer all of the conveniences, products and services for which CBH was known.

Customers can continue to use their existing CBH checks, debit cards and ATM cards. New Metro Bank checks will be issued upon reorder. New Metro Bank debit and ATM cards will be issued to customers later this year.

CBH and its parent company, Pennsylvania Commerce Bancorp Inc., are not affiliates of TD Bank.
